Key Features Comparison

DeaDBeeF
DeaDBeeF Features
  • Supports a wide variety of audio formats including MP3, OGG, FLAC, WAV, etc
  • Customizable user interface with skins and color schemes
  • Equalizer and audio effects
  • Playlist management
  • Supports plugins to add extra functionality
  • Keyboard shortcuts for playback control
  • Gapless playback
OmniPlayer
OmniPlayer Features
  • Supports a wide variety of media formats
  • Clean and intuitive interface
  • Advanced features like video effects and screen recording
  • Can play YouTube videos directly
  • Customizable keyboard shortcuts
  • Video bookmarking
  • Supports playlists
  • Skins and visual themes
  • Plugin support
  • Media library management

Pros & Cons Analysis

DeaDBeeF
DeaDBeeF
Pros
  • Free and open source
  • Lightweight and fast
  • Good audio quality
  • Very customizable
  • Cross-platform compatibility
Cons
  • Limited metadata editing capabilities
  • No built-in CD ripping
  • Not as full-featured as some commercial players
OmniPlayer
OmniPlayer
Pros
  • Clean and easy to use interface
  • Supports many media formats
  • Lots of advanced features
  • Can play YouTube videos
  • Extensive customization options
  • Good format support
  • Lightweight on system resources
Cons
  • Lacks support for some niche media formats
  • Skins and plugins can be hit or miss in quality
  • Default skin looks a bit dated
  • No mobile or cloud sync features
